## Formula sandbox tuning

User-supplied formulas in Gridmoor execute inside a restricted interpreter with hard ceilings on time, memory, and call depth. Reviewers should confirm any change to these ceilings is justified in the PR description, since raising them widens the abuse surface. Defaults were chosen from production traces. The current limits are as follows.

limits module of tafog-fawip:
WEIGHTS = {
    "julix": 57,
    "lamys": 992,
    "kasvan": 209,
    "quenok": 750,
    "alddor": 259,
    "oliath": 1009,
    "wenix": 815,
}

### CI Note: Mergewell Dedup Pipeline Failures

Support team: if the Mergewell dedup job fails in CI with a fuzzy-match timeout, the cause is usually the nightly customer snapshot exceeding the 4M-record cap. Re-run the job with the partitioned matcher enabled; do not lower the match threshold, as that produces false merges. If the partitioned run also fails, escalate to the data platform rotation. Reference the failing pipeline run by the token below.

session token of tajef-bageg = htk21_5d90d574934f3ccae6437

## Releases

Backfillr releases are cut from `main` on the first Monday monthly. Tag, build, publish — no manual steps. Nightly backfill schedules are versioned with the binary; never patch them in place. Each release artifact must be signed before upload, using the maintainer key listed below.

signing key of yajog-kafof = bky19_orbYRY3Abj3KpZesMie

MEMO — Finance Team

Heads up: the Larkspindle migration has slipped another six weeks. The vendor underestimated the data cleanup, and Priya's team is stretched covering it. Budget impact is roughly one extra month of contractor spend — please hold the Q4 accrual open. We'll re-baseline once the new schedule lands. The plan this connects to is set out below.

confidential, bahap-bajog: Zorethix Works is in early talks to buy Kelethox Foods for about $30.7 million. The Ralvan launch date is September 19, and nothing goes to the press before then.